Metal roof flashing repair services involve fixing or replacing the metal strips that are installed around roof features such as chimneys, vents, skylights, and roof edges. These flashing components serve as a barrier to prevent water from seeping into the roof and causing damage to the underlying structure. When flashing becomes damaged, corroded, or improperly installed, it can lead to leaks, water stains, and even structural issues if left unaddressed. Professional contractors specializing in metal roof flashing repair can assess the condition of existing flashing, identify problem areas, and carry out the necessary repairs to restore the roof’s protective barrier.
Problems that prompt the need for flashing repair typically include visible signs of water intrusion, such as damp spots on ceilings or walls, or the appearance of rust and corrosion on the flashing itself. Additionally, flashing may become loose or displaced over time due to weather exposure or high winds, creating gaps that allow water to penetrate. In some cases, flashing may have been improperly installed initially, leading to ongoing leaks or damage. Addressing these issues promptly with professional repair services helps prevent more extensive and costly damage to the roof and the interior of the property.

The overview below groups typical Metal Roof Flashing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Joppa,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Minor flashing repairs typically cost between $250 and $600 for many routine jobs. These projects often involve fixing leaks or replacing small sections and are common in residential properties in Joppa, MD. Many local pros handle these repairs within this middle range.
Moderate Repairs - For more extensive flashing repairs or multiple areas, costs generally range from $600 to $1,500. These projects may include replacing damaged sections or addressing ongoing leaks and are less frequent but still common among local service providers.
Large or Complex Projects - Larger repairs involving significant flashing replacement or structural work can reach $1,500 to $3,000 or more. Fewer projects fall into this tier, often requiring specialized skills or additional materials, especially on older or complex roof systems.
Full Roof Flashing Replacement - Complete flashing replacements can cost $3,000 to $5,000+ depending on roof size and complexity. These are typically larger projects that local contractors undertake less frequently but are essential for long-term roof integrity in Joppa, MD.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
